A common source of nickel used in the preparation of supported nickel catalysts for hydrogenation and steam reforming processes
A primary component in nickel plating baths used to deposit protective and decorative nickel coatings on various substrates
A high-purity chemical used in laboratory settings for the detection and quantification of specific ions and complexometric titrations
A starting material utilized in the synthesis of nickel-based nanoparticles and coordination polymers with applications in energy storage and sensing.
Nickel (II) Chloride Hexahydrate is a water-soluble inorganic compound that serves as a primary source of nickel for chemical synthesis and electroplating, and it is used as a precursor for nickel oxide films and catalysts
This compound is widely used in the electroplating, automotive, electronics, petrochemical, textile, and pharmaceutical industries, as well as in battery manufacturing and biotechnology research
It is highly soluble in water and is typically used in aqueous plating solutions, cell culture media, and as a precursor in hydrothermal or liquid-phase synthesis protocols
